Adrenaline |
Doubles Physical damage dealt while in Critical status |
|
Brawler |
Increases attack when unarmed. Scales with Strength and Level |
|
Focus |
Increases Physical damage dealt by 1.5x when HP is full |
|
Headsman |
Recover MP when dealing fatal damage to a Foe in the amount of Foe level divided by 4. |
|
Inquisitor |
Restores MP when dealing Physical damage. (See Damage to MP chart) |
|
Last Stand |
Halves Physical damage recieved when in Critical status |
|
Martyr |
Restores MP upon being damaged. (See Damage to MP chart) |
|
Spellbound |
Beneficial statuses last 50% longer |

Achilles |
Causes a foe to gain vulnerability to a random status. Most enemies are immune. |
|
Bonecrusher |
Reduces one Foe’s HP to 0. Deals between 0% to 99% damage to the user, and KOs the user if it misses. |
|
Expose |
Lowers the Defense stat of one Foe to 90% of current. Nothing is immune. Highly recommended. |
|
First Aid |
Restores HP to an ally in Critical condition. Not recommended. |
|
Libra |
Puts Libra status on the user. Shows Foe's HP, statuses, and level as well as reveals traps. Generally very useful. |
|
Numerology |
Deals damage to enemies, doubles with each successive hit when used repeatedly. Deals area damage as well. |
|
Revive |
Fullly restores HP of one KO’d character, consumes all of user’s HP. |
|
Shades of Black |
Randomly casts a Black Magick without consuming MP or needing to have the license |

Wielding Poles and wearing Light Armor, Monks are masters of close-range combat. They are the only Job to feature all sixteen Battle Lores, but only have one Swiftness. Once you are able to unlock some abilities, the Monk opens up in an amazing way and can be transformed into a powerful healer. The Monk Job also brings Wither to the table to go with Expose, and a pair of Swiftness Licenses are available as well (even though these Licenses are blocked by Ultima from the start). The Monk is a full-time Job, and is a pillar of any team.
Monk has a lot in common with Knight in that they are powerful, slow Jobs that can use Espers to open up valuable healing powers. It’s useful to combine Monk with a Job that either overlaps on Locks, like Machinist, or that doesn’t require many Espers, like Foebreaker. A Job with some Magick Lores and Channelings is very useful, as is a Job which doesn’t require them to use Espers for Swiftnesses. Bushi and Shikari both fit well in this way, though you may find them having applications elsewhere. Monk is a powerful Job on its own, and it’s workable to simply pick up a Job that was left in the lurch elsewhere.
Due to their huge pile of Health Point Augments and their MP-hungry healing, you may actually lean toward more magick-heavy team members for the Monk Job. If you happen to pair them with a Heavy Armor class, Strength becomes basically irrelevant. In this case, you can consider someone like Penelo for this combination. Without the huge buffs from Heavy Armor, someone like Vaan or Ashe has a great mix of stats that fits perfectly with the Monk Job.
